Output dfc32528368aea21fce48acd88c9533391e97704c9cfa2e7d31ea5f1259a153a:6

value
76000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c9a6e415b85c45f81f7de77985704f5dea327f OP_EQUAL
address
38nKXLR8G7j6atsKcNoPDS76rJ71XVN5vf
transaction
dfc32528368aea21fce48acd88c9533391e97704c9cfa2e7d31ea5f1259a153a
spent
true